RBI Urges Strong Governance in Financial System

Reserve Bank of India Governor emphasizes the importance of strong governance for financial stability, calling it the core of resilience for stakeholders in the system.

Mumbai, Jun 27 (PTI) Reserve Bank Governor Shaktikanta Das on Thursday asked all stakeholders in the financial system to assign "highest priority" to governance.
In his foreword to the central bank's half-yearly Financial Stability Report, Das said the Indian economy is exhibiting strength and resilience, with strong macroeconomic fundamentals and buffers amid global headwinds.
RBI stress tests show that even under severe stress scenarios, banks' and non-banks' buffers will remain above minimum regulatory capital levels, Das said.
The RBI is watchful of emerging risks from cyber hazards, climate change and global spillover, he said, asking all the stakeholders to devote focus on governance.
"The highest priority must be assigned to governance as strong governance is at the core of resilience of stakeholders in the financial system," he said.
